Abstract
This paper presents multidirectional view on developmental disorders. The definition of this term and its scale of range is presented. The term of auxological norm as well as methods and criteria used for interpretation of failure to thrive are discussed. Developmental disorders are usually understood as somatic development disturbances in different phases of ontogenesis - mainly in growing, sexual maturation and nourishment. The authors point however that developmental disorders refer also to psychomotor and social development.
